Kendra Scott Donates to Mental Health First Aid Colorado!

Tomorrow, May 20th, in honor of May is Mental Health Month, Kendra Scott jewelers will be donating 20% of their proceeds to Mental Health First Aid Colorado at their Cherry Creek location from 2pm – 4pm!

They will also honor the 20% discount at their online store for both May 20th and 21st.

We hope that you will participate in this great event so Mental Health First Aid Colorado can continue to train folks across our state on how to identify, understand, and respond to individuals experiencing a behavioral health issue.
